Barcode technology lets you manage inventory like the pros. Here’s how it improves operations:
Manual systems average 96% accuracy. That 3% difference? It’s the reason your tech is hunting for a part that "should be here." Barcodes update inventory in real time and nearly eliminate entry mistakes.
Instead of handwriting or typing long part numbers, a quick scan logs everything - receipts, returns, usage - in seconds.
Every scan creates an audit trail. If something disappears, you know when it was used and by whom. That visibility discourages theft and mistakes.
Barcode systems notify you when stock is low and can even auto-generate POs. No more getting caught off guard by an empty shelf.
Best part? Most systems work with phones or tablets, so you don’t need fancy scanners to get started.
